Recipe: Braised Short Ribs of Beef (Sears crock pot recipe, 1970's)

Main Dishes - Beef and Other Meats
BRAISED SHORT RIBS OF BEEF

2 tablespoons bacon fat or peanut oil
3 pounds short ribs, cut in chunks
1 clove garlic, crushed
2 cups sliced onions
1 cup chili sauce
1/2 cup vinegar
1 teaspoon curry powder
1 1/2 teaspoons paprika
1 tablespoon brown sugar
1 cup beef stock
1 teaspoon salt
Freshly ground pepper
1/2 teaspoon dry mustard

Heat fat or oil in a skillet and brown the meat well on all sides. Remove to crock pot.

Add onions and garlic to the skillet and brown them lightly. Place over meat in crock pot.

Mix remaining ingredients together well and pour over meat and onions in crock pot.

Cover and cook on #2 (low) setting 9-10 hours, until ribs are very tender.

Makes 4 servings
From: Recipelink.com
Source: Recipe booklet: Sears Crockery Cooker: Slow Cooking the Old Fashioned Way, 1970's
